I flew through this novel of self-discovery. June has moved in the middle of the year to Virginia (from North Carolina, and she's freezing throughout the winter months lol) after having been expelled from her former school for being caught drunk with her best friend. The best friend, Jess, gets to stay because her parents make a large contribution to the school. So June is in a new town with her grandmother, a day student at a boarding school. 

She misses Jess intensely, but a lucky physics group assignment joins her with Claire and Kitty, who are dating, but are super welcoming. June isn't always the third wheel because she meets Sam, Claire's cousin in photography class. She'd never been interested in anything artistic before, but the elective fit in her schedule, and she found herself elbow deep in developer! 

Developing prints is an apt metaphor for how June learns things about herself and who she is when she's not with Jess.
